SCHOLARSHIPS & GRANTS

Scholarship Information

Scholarships are available for individuals to attend the Annual MNA Conference. You must be a member of MNA at the time of application to be considered for a scholarship.

Each scholarship covers a portion of the registration, the difference is paid by the applicant. Optional field trip fees are not covered and must be paid by the applicant.

Evaluation will be based on responses provided to all questions on the application. The information provided is confidential and will only be shared within the Scholarship Review Committee. The application deadline for the 2023 conference is Friday, October 6, 2023.

Grant Guidelines

Grants are now available.
Please see below for details. 

The Minnesota Naturalists’ Association (MNA) has
a small grant fund to support our members in furthering environmental education in Minnesota and beyond. Grants will:

· Fund up to $150 per request
(Total of $300 Annually)

· Fund up to 3 requests per fiscal year
(January to December)

· Be available until the money is depleted

· Be available for full or partial funding of requests

· Applications will be considered immediately upon receipt by the Grants and Scholarship Committee.

Grant Guidelines

1. Applicant must be a current MNA member. Visit our membership page for more info about becoming a member

2. Grant money is to be used to further environmental education/interpretation in Minnesota.

3. Applications will be considered for:

    a. Education/training opportunities
(workshops and classes), educational facilities
or supplies not funded by applicant’s employer.

    b. Grassroots environmental action, including cost for travel, food, lodging, materials and printing costs; attendance at environmental advocacy conferences and workshops, i.e. Alternative Energy Fair, Bioregional Workshop, Forestry Best Management.

    c. Costs associated with an organized effort
of environmental damage, remediation,                restoration, stabilization, etc.

4. If the application is granted, the recipient is required to:

    a. Share information and results of action
with MNA members within one year, including a      written summary for the MNA Newsletter

    b. In order to receive reimbursements the
grant recipient must provide receipts of money spent to the MNA Scholarship and Grants Committee within one year (from the date the grant was awarded).
